Description
- I/O module is physically plugged in
- I/O module is not physically plugged in
Number of preamble bytes. The value must
be increased in the event of
communications problems.
Number of retries for HART telegram
transmissions. The value must be increased
in the event of communications problems
- Diagnostics for Channel 1 / 2 are
deactivated
- Diagnostics for Channel 1 / 2 are activated
Analog filter time for the input Channel 1/2
